Whole house renovation services involve a comprehensive approach to updating and improving an entire property. This process typically includes remodeling multiple rooms, upgrading structural elements, modernizing electrical and plumbing systems, and enhancing overall functionality and aesthetics. Homeowners often choose this service when their property requires significant updates to meet current standards, improve energy efficiency, or better suit their lifestyle. Engaging experienced contractors ensures that all aspects of the renovation are coordinated smoothly, resulting in a cohesive transformation of the entire home.

These services are particularly effective for addressing a variety of common problems. Older homes may suffer from outdated wiring, inefficient insulation, or structural issues that compromise safety and comfort. Homes with multiple outdated features or those experiencing ongoing maintenance challenges can benefit from a full overhaul. Whole house renovations can also resolve layout inefficiencies, such as cramped or poorly designed spaces, by reconfiguring floor plans to create a more open, functional living environment. This approach helps homeowners eliminate patchwork repairs and create a unified, modern home.

The overview below groups typical Whole House Renovation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s range from $250-$600 for many routine jobs like patching drywall or replacing fixtures. Most projects fall within this middle range, with fewer exceeding $1,000 for more involved tasks.

Major Renovations - larger projects such as kitchen or bathroom remodels often cost between $10,000 and $30,000, depending on the scope and materials. These are common for extensive updates but can go higher for premium finishes.

Full Home Overhaul - comprehensive renovations of an entire house can range from $50,000 to well over $150,000, especially for older homes requiring significant updates. Many projects stay within this high-tier range, though some may be more budget-conscious.

Custom or Complex Projects - highly customized renovations or those involving structural changes can exceed $200,000, with costs varying widely based on design complexity. Such projects are less frequent but represent the upper end of typical renovation budgets.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ating potential contractors for a Whole House Renovation,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should seek out service providers who have a proven track record of completing renovations comparable in scope and style to the desired outcome. This experience can provide insight into their ability to handle the complexities of a comprehensive renovation, anticipate challenges, and deliver a finished result that aligns with expectations. Verifying the types of projects a contractor has worked on helps ensure they possess relevant expertise and understand the nuances involved in transforming an entire home.

Clear, written expectations are essential for a successful renovation process. Homeowners should look for service providers who can articulate their approach, outline the scope of work, and provide detailed descriptions of what will be included in the project. Having these expectations documented hel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ures everyone is on the same page from the outset. Service providers who communicate their plans clearly and are willing to put expectations in writing demonstrate professionalism and a commitment to transparency, making it easier to manage the project smoothly.

Reputable references and good communication are key indicators of a reliable contractor. Homeowners should seek out local pros who can provide references from past clients with similar projects, offering insight into their work quality and professionalism. Additionally, effective communication throughout the process-prompt responses, clarity, and openness-can significantly impact the overall experience. Choosing service providers with positive references and strong communication skills helps foster a collaborative relationship, making it easier to address questions and ensure the renovation progresses as planned.
